                          @KeesV, in the app-menu: "Navigation settings - Functional - Start tracklog automatically" needs te be enabled. After that, tracking of routes and tracks should be started automatically. For straight A to B routes, tracklog will not be started automatically, because those are considered not scenic and therefore not interesting enough for tracking.
